Chocolate Cookie Crust

  1. Preheat the oven to 375F.
  2. Combine the crumbs and butter and mix well.
  3. Firmly and evenly press the mixture into a 9- or 10-inch pie plate.
  4. Bake for 8 to 10 minutes, until the crust darkens to a deeper (almost black) brown, then cool on a wire rack for at least 30 minutes before filling.
  5. This crust can be made a day ahead and stored in the refrigerator.
